In memory of a dearly departed friend, we go back 60 years to a very special nautical episode that we know he would have enjoyed. 
In an exciting departure from normal service, Raymond Baxter presents to us live from the first ever commercial crossing of the Channel by hovercraft. And along the way he shows us a whole range of exciting new developments in the world of seagoing transportation. This includes:

- Hydrofoils
- Research submarines
- Aquanauts (the "Dandies of the Deep")
- Underwater ejector seats
- Dracone barges
- Plenty of hovercraft chat
